What's Happening?
Presight, a global artificial intelligence company, has signed memorandums of understanding (MoUs) with the governments of Burkina Faso, Côte d’Ivoire, and Gabon. These agreements aim to support digital
transformation efforts in these countries by integrating data, analytics, and automation into public sector operations. In Côte d’Ivoire, Presight will collaborate with the Ministry of Digital Transition and Digitisation and the Ministry of State, Public Services and Modernisation of the Administration to develop advanced digital platforms. In Burkina Faso, the focus will be on deploying AI-enabled systems to improve public service delivery and financial transparency. The partnership with Gabon involves renewing an existing MoU to continue modernizing public services using AI.
